The Hell with Heroes

Aug 28, 1968
1h 42m
★ 5.2

They all had something to sell...courage...sex...corruption!

Overview

In 1946 North Africa, two former US Air Force pilots are forced to work for an international smuggler to get money needed for their return to civilian life after fighting in World War II.
